Access Pharmaceuticals Licenses MuGard(TM) to RHEI Pharmaceuticals, Inc.

DALLAS and NEW HAVEN, Conn., Jan. 14 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 -- Access Pharmaceuticals, Inc. and RHEI Pharmaceuticals, Inc. (“RHEI”), a specialty pharmaceutical company focused on bringing proprietary medicines to the China market, today announced the signing of a definitive licensing agreement under which RHEI, which has more than 110 national sales representatives penetrating large volume hospitals, will market Access’s proprietary product MuGard(TM) in the Peoples Republic of China and certain other Southeast Asian countries. MuGard(TM) has received marketing allowance from the U.S. Food and Drug Administration for the management of oral mucositis, a debilitating side effect of many anticancer treatments. Oral mucositis has become a significant unmet medical need as a result of improved medical care in China and the Southeast Asian region. RHEI will be responsible for marketing MuGard in the People’s Republic of China, Hong Kong, Macau, Taiwan, Brunei, Cambodia, Indonesia, Laos, Malaysia, Myanmar, Philippines, Singapore, Thailand and Vietnam, as well as for manufacturing and for obtaining the necessary regulatory approvals for the product in the territory.

About MuGard(TM):

MuGard is a ready-to-use mucoadhesive oral wound rinse. The mucoadhesive formulation forms a protective coating over the oral mucosa when washed around the mouth. In a retrospective comparison of cancer patients receiving standard mucositis care with those patients receiving MuGard, the incidence and severity of mucositis was significantly lower in the MuGard treated group. Up to 40% of all patients receiving chemotherapy and/or radiotherapy develop moderate to severe mucositis, and almost all patients receiving radiotherapy for head and neck cancer and those undergoing stem cell transplantation develop mucositis. Updated clinical practice guidelines for the prevention and treatment of mucositis recommend the use of a preventive oral care regimen as part of routine supportive care along with a therapeutic oral care regimen if mucositis develops. The market for the treatment of oral mucositis is estimated to be in excess of $1 billion worldwide.

About RHEI Pharmaceuticals:

RHEI Pharmaceuticals is a venture backed specialty pharmaceutical company with operations in the U.S. and in China that acquires, licenses, develops and commercializes in China proprietary drug therapies based upon the unmet needs of the emerging China pharmaceuticals market. RHEI leverages its proprietary and extensive network of experienced clinical development and regulatory professionals in China to expedite approvals for pharmaceuticals new to the China market. RHEI’s growing sales and marketing capabilities then provide broad patient access in China to these new and critically necessary therapeutics. RHEI specializes in hospital-based proprietary products with a therapeutic focus on urgent unmet needs in the areas of cancer, cardiovascular disease, diabetes, neurology, and other life threatening conditions.

About Access:

Access Pharmaceuticals, Inc. is a biotechnology company that leverages its proprietary nano-polymer chemistry expertise to develop proprietary products. Access’ products include ProLindac(TM), a novel DACH platinum drug that is currently in Phase 2 clinical testing of patients with ovarian cancer and MuGard(TM) for the management of patients with mucositis. The Company also has other advanced drug delivery technologies including Cobalamin(TM)-mediated targeted delivery and oral drug delivery.
